The luminous seascape Segelboote Am Strand by Dutch realist George Willem Opdenhoff (1807–1873) transports viewers to a windswept coastline where beached sailboats tilt against golden sands under a brooding sky. Executed with precise brushwork characteristic of the Hague School’s marine painting tradition, the work balances documentary detail—note the weathered hulls’ wood grain and the translucent wave foam—with poetic atmosphere, as steely blues in the clouds echo the chilly North Sea. Opdenhoff, though less famed than contemporaries like Hendrik Mesdag, was pivotal in advancing 19th-century Dutch maritime realism, capturing transitional moments where man-made objects submit to nature’s forces. The painting’s diagonal composition, with boats pointing toward the horizon, creates dynamic tension between grounded reality and escapist longing.
